Paperback, , The magistrate's folly by Lisa Karon Richardson () 5 editions published between 20in English and held by WorldCat member libraries worldwide. · Lisa Karon Richardson ===== Lisa Karon Richardson is an award-winning author and a member of American Christian Fiction Writers. Lisa is the author of several novels including The Peacock Throne. Her novella, Impressed by Love, was a Carol Award Finalist. Lisa and her husband are currently planting a small home missions church in America, having previously been missionaries to Brand: Lion Hudson.

The Peacock Throne by Lisa Karon Richardson is a historical mystery with some adventure and romance. It is well written. It has many twists and turns and keeps you www.doorway.ru Karon Richardson has done a great deal of research which makes for an interesting and accurate historical setting.
